Open Loop Data ============== Data Collection --------------- We have transferred the following RSR open loop data to Stanford: YYYY/DDD DSS RSR RSR CH KSPS BT REC RECS RSR MAX START STOP ID RS LEN FILE NAME SNR -------- --- -------- -------- --- -- ---- -- ----- ----- ------------ ----- 2003/225 34 13:41:00 13:51:00 3 1 2 16 8260 601 32251341.RSR 62.7 2003/225 34 15:38:00 15:48:00 3 1 2 16 8260 601 32251538.RSR 62.8 2003/225 34 17:36:00 17:46:00 3 1 2 16 8260 601 32251736.RSR 63.0 2003/225 34 19:34:00 19:44:00 3 1 2 16 8260 601 32251934.RSR 63.0 2003/226 26 09:18:00 09:28:00 3 1 2 16 8260 601 32260918.RSR 64.2 2003/226 26 11:15:00 11:25:00 3 1 2 16 8260 601 32261115.RSR 63.8 2003/226 26 13:13:00 13:23:00 3 1 2 16 8260 601 32261313.RSR 62.6 2003/226 43 13:13:00 13:23:00 3 1 2 16 8260 601 3226131D.RSR 69.9 2003/226 43 15:11:00 15:21:00 3 1 2 16 8260 601 32261511.RSR 69.9 2003/226 43 17:08:00 17:18:00 3 1 2 16 8260 601 32261708.RSR 69.5 Anomalies --------- All three measurements from DSS 26 on day 226 had increased noise power levels for frequencies close to the carrier. Noise levels were as much as 10 dB higher than usual within +/-200 Hz of the carrier. It is possible this "skirt" around the carrier is caused by the recent high signal input to the front end. But its shape is much different in these DSS 26 data from any other we have seen with MGS. All three measurements also had +/-60 and 180 Hz frequency spurs -- typical for high SNR conditions. Occultations affected were 19812i through 19814i, with start times 2003/226-09:18:00 through 13:13:00.
